/ˈbɑt͡ʃi/ · noun
(sports, uncountable) A game, similar to bowls or pétanque, played on a long, narrow, dirt-covered court, or informally, as a lawn game..
The object is throw or roll the bocces as close as possible to the pallino.
The side with their bocces closest to the pallino earns points.
